Definition of Electrolytic Zinc Market:
The Electrolytic Zinc Market encompasses the production, distribution, and sale of high-purity zinc produced through the electrolytic process. This process involves dissolving zinc ore or concentrates in a sulfuric acid solution, followed by the electrolysis of the zinc sulfate solution to deposit pure zinc at the cathode. The Electrolytic Zinc Market is a critical component of the global metals and mining industry, supplying a versatile material used in numerous applications across various sectors.
Key components of the Electrolytic Zinc Market include zinc concentrates, sulfuric acid, electrolytic cells, and refining equipment. The market also encompasses services such as zinc plating, galvanizing, and die-casting, which add value to the primary product. Electrolytic zinc is primarily available in various forms, including Special High Grade (SHG) zinc, High Grade (HG) zinc, and Continuous Galvanizing Grade (CGG) zinc, each tailored to specific end-use requirements.
Key terms related to the Electrolytic Zinc Market include: Electrolysis (the process of using electric current to drive a non-spontaneous chemical reaction), Cathode (the electrode where zinc is deposited during electrolysis), Anode (the electrode where oxygen is evolved during electrolysis), Electrolyte (the zinc sulfate solution used in the electrolytic process), Galvanizing (the process of coating steel with zinc to protect against corrosion), Die-casting (a manufacturing process for producing accurately dimensioned, sharply defined, smooth, or textured-surface metal parts), and Zinc Alloys (mixtures of zinc with other metals to enhance specific properties). By Type:
Special High Grade (SHG) Zinc: SHG zinc is the purest form of electrolytic zinc, containing a minimum of 99.995% zinc. It is primarily used in applications requiring high purity, such as die-casting alloys, electronics, and chemical production. Its superior purity ensures excellent performance and reliability in these critical applications.
High Grade (HG) Zinc: HG zinc has a zinc content of 99.95% and is widely used in galvanizing, brass production, and battery manufacturing. Its versatility and cost-effectiveness make it a popular choice for a broad range of industrial applications.
Continuous Galvanizing Grade (CGG) Zinc: CGG zinc is specifically designed for continuous galvanizing lines, where it is used to coat steel sheets with a layer of zinc for corrosion protection. It offers excellent adhesion and corrosion resistance, making it ideal for automotive, construction, and appliance applications.
By Application:
Galvanizing: Galvanizing is the most significant application of electrolytic zinc, accounting for a substantial share of the market. It involves coating steel with a layer of zinc to protect against corrosion, extending the lifespan of steel structures and components.
Die-casting: Die-casting is another major application, where electrolytic zinc is used to produce zinc die-cast alloys for manufacturing various components in the automotive, electrical, and hardware industries. Zinc die-cast alloys offer excellent strength, durability, and dimensional accuracy.
Chemicals: Electrolytic zinc is used in the production of various zinc compounds, such as zinc oxide, zinc sulfate, and zinc phosphate. These compounds are used in fertilizers, pharmaceuticals, pigments, and rubber production.
Batteries: The use of electrolytic zinc in zinc-air and zinc-manganese batteries is an emerging application, driven by the growing demand for energy storage solutions. Zinc-air batteries offer high energy density and are considered a promising alternative to lithium-ion batteries in certain applications.

Fluctuating zinc prices can create uncertainty and volatility in the market, affecting the profitability of producers and the cost-competitiveness of electrolytic zinc. Zinc prices are influenced by various factors, including supply and demand dynamics, global economic conditions, and geopolitical events. Producers need to manage price risk effectively through hedging strategies and cost optimization measures.
Environmental concerns related to electrolytic zinc production, such as emissions of sulfur dioxide and heavy metals, can pose regulatory and social challenges. Electrolytic zinc producers need to invest in pollution control technologies and adopt sustainable production practices to minimize their environmental footprint and comply with stringent environmental regulations. Furthermore, the disposal of byproducts from the electrolytic process, such as jarosite and iron residues, requires careful management to prevent environmental contamination.

The Electrolytic Zinc Market relies on several key technologies for the production of high-purity zinc. These technologies include leaching, purification, and electrolysis processes, which are essential for extracting zinc from ore and refining it to meet stringent quality standards. Advancements in these technologies are continuously improving the efficiency, sustainability, and cost-effectiveness of electrolytic zinc production.
Leaching technologies involve dissolving zinc ore or concentrates in a sulfuric acid solution to extract zinc. The leaching process can be carried out using various methods, such as heap leaching, tank leaching, and pressure leaching. Tank leaching is the most common method, where zinc concentrates are agitated in a sulfuric acid solution to dissolve the zinc. Pressure leaching involves using high pressure and temperature to enhance the dissolution of zinc, particularly for refractory ores.
Electrolysis is the core technology in electrolytic zinc production, where an electric current is passed through the zinc sulfate solution to deposit pure zinc at the cathode. The electrolysis process is typically carried out in electrolytic cells, which consist of anodes, cathodes, and an electrolyte solution. The design and operation of electrolytic cells are critical for achieving high zinc purity and current efficiency. Automation technologies, such as automated cell monitoring and control systems, are also being increasingly adopted to optimize the electrolysis process.
